Licensing and Contractor Regulation Requirements

If you want to find out if your roofer is legit, you’ll need to make sure they are licensed and regulated. Understanding these requirements is crucial for homeowners seeking reputable professionals to handle their roofing needs.

Licensing Standards

Licensing serves as a foundational aspect of legitimacy for roofing companies. Each state and locality establishes criteria for obtaining a roofing contractor’s license. These standards typically include factors such as:

  • Demonstrated competency in roofing techniques and practices.
  • Minimum levels of experience in the roofing industry.
  • Compliance with safety regulations and building codes.
  • Financial stability and insurance coverage.

Certification and Endorsements

Manufacturers of roofing materials, such as GAF, CertainTeed, and Owens Corning, offer certification programs for contractors who meet their installation and customer service standards. Homeowners can trust certified contractors to have undergone training and demonstrated proficiency in using specific roofing products.

Regulatory Compliance and Accountability

Licensed roofing contractors are subject to regulatory oversight and accountability measures, providing homeowners with recourse in case of disputes or grievances. Regulatory bodies may investigate complaints against contractors and take disciplinary action against those found to violate licensing standards or ethical codes.

Homeowners can feel confident hiring licensed contractors, knowing that they are held to industry standards and are accountable for their conduct and workmanship.

The Dangers of Working with an Unlicensed Contractor

Engaging with an unlicensed contractor poses significant risks and potential consequences. Without a license, contractors may lack the necessary skills, training, and legal authorization to perform roofing work safely and effectively. Here are some dangers associated with working with unlicensed contractors:

Safety and Quality of Work

Unlicensed contractors may lack the expertise needed to accurately assess, repair, or install roofs. Substandard workmanship can result in leaks, structural damage, and premature roof failure, ultimately costing you more in repairs or replacements. Unlicensed contractors may not prioritize safety measures, putting themselves, their workers, and your property at risk.

Legal and Financial Consequences

Hiring an unlicensed contractor can have legal and financial consequences. If property damage or injuries occur during the project, you may be liable for medical expenses or repairs, as unlicensed contractors often lack liability insurance. Additionally, you may encounter difficulties in seeking recourse or compensation for poor workmanship or contractual disputes.

Voided Warranties

Many roofing materials come with manufacturer warranties that mandate installation by a licensed contractor. Hiring an unlicensed contractor could void these warranties, leaving you without recourse in case of defects or issues with the roofing materials.

Unethical Practices

Unlicensed contractors may engage in unethical or fraudulent practices, such as using subpar materials, cutting corners, or failing to honor contractual agreements. Without regulatory oversight, they may operate with impunity, leaving you vulnerable to exploitation or deception.
